Three parliamentary committees to convene today in Singha Durbar



KATHMANDU: Three key committees under the Federal Parliament are scheduled to meet today to discuss a range of legislative and oversight matters.

The Committee on the Monitoring and Evaluation of Implementation of the Directive Principles, Policies and Obligations of the State will hold its meeting at 8:15 am in the meeting room of the Infrastructure Development Committee at Singha Durbar.

The agenda includes a review of the progress of the Federal Parliament Building currently under construction, along with discussion on other pressing issues.

Later, at 11 am, the Federal Enablement and National Concerns Committee is set to meet at Singha Durbar. This meeting will focus on evaluating the committee’s work plan, including future plans for field monitoring and stakeholder interaction.

In the afternoon, the Legislative Management Committee will convene at 1 pm, also at Singha Durbar, to deliberate on the draft report of the Ships (Operation and Management) Bill-2024.

All three meetings are expected to contribute to legislative progress and reinforce parliamentary oversight on federal matters.
